Bulk Commodities:
One category of freight that is extensively moved by railroads is bulk commodities. These commodities are typically loose, unpackaged goods that are transported in large quantities. Some examples of bulk commodities include coal, grains, ores, and petroleum. Railroads are well-suited for transporting bulk commodities due to their capacity to carry large volumes of goods.
Coal, a vital resource for energy production, constitutes a significant portion of freight transported by railroads. It is particularly important for power plants and industrial facilities. Railroads provide a cost-effective means of transporting coal from mines to power stations, where it is used to generate electricity. Due to its high volume and weight, rail transport offers an efficient solution for the coal industry.
Raw Materials:
Aside from bulk commodities, railroads are instrumental in transporting raw materials to manufacturing facilities. Industries such as steel, agriculture, and mining heavily rely on rail transportation to move raw materials. Iron ore, for instance, is transported by rail to steel mills where it is transformed into steel. Similarly, agricultural products like wheat and corn are transported by rail to food processing plants and markets.
By utilizing rail transport, industries can benefit from the economies of scale, reduced costs, and more efficient logistics. Railroads are capable of handling large quantities of raw materials, ensuring a steady supply to meet growing demands.
Intermodal Freight:
Another significant category of freight transported by railroads is intermodal freight. Intermodal transportation involves the use of multiple modes of transport, such as railways, trucks, and ships, to move cargo. Railroads typically handle the long-haul portion of intermodal transport, acting as a backbone in the supply chain.
Containerized goods, which are packed in standardized containers, are a common form of intermodal freight. Railways serve as an integral link in transporting containers between ports and inland distribution centers. This method provides a seamless transition between different modes of transport, reducing congestion on highways and allowing for more efficient movement of goods.
Automobiles:
Railroads are also involved in transporting automobiles, both domestically and internationally. Cars are typically transported in specialized railcars known as "autoracks." Autoracks are enclosed railcars that can hold multiple vehicles, ensuring safe and secure transportation.
Rail transport offers advantages for automobile transportation, such as reduced fuel consumption and decreased traffic congestion. It is especially useful for long-distance transportation of vehicles from manufacturing plants to distribution centers or dealerships. Railroads provide a cost-effective solution for moving large numbers of vehicles efficiently.
Chemicals:
The transportation of chemicals, including hazardous materials, is another crucial aspect of railroad freight. Chemicals are used in various industries such as manufacturing, agriculture, and pharmaceuticals. Rail transport is well-suited for carrying chemicals as it provides safety measures and containment systems to prevent leaks and spills.
Due to safety regulations and the specialized handling requirements of certain chemicals, railroads offer a reliable transportation option. They have the necessary infrastructure, such as tank cars and containment facilities, to transport chemicals securely. Rail transport ensures the prompt delivery of chemicals to their intended destinations, supporting various industries'' supply chains.
